如图示应用,输出波形如图,本人小小白,求高人指点!
Kailyn Chen:
您好,这个波形是测量的哪里的波形?
jonsy wu:
回复 Kailyn Chen:
您好,所测量的位置是ADC处,另外R1:R2=3:1
谢谢
Kailyn Chen:
回复 jonsy wu:
恩,波形震荡的原因很可能和补偿电容3.3pF有关,尝试将其减小再看下波形。
jonsy wu:
回复 Kailyn Chen:
您好,反复检查目前发现波形震荡两个来源 1:单片机开启AD转换后,信号纹波变大,2:光电二极管自身信号不干净
下图是没有光电二极管时测得的波形,明显看到AD开启后纹波变大
下图是有光电二极管时测得的波形
Kailyn Chen:
回复 jonsy wu:
关于光电二极管这边不干净的问题,在进入后端TIA运放时候,建议是对TIA的输入做guard ring保护处理,目的是为了保证光电二极管电流都进入到运放输入端,减少漏电流的产生。
KW X:
亲;你的电路接的有些问题。该光耦实际是LED-diode结构,在DIODE有接二极管阳极的屏蔽。所以;实际上在光耦两侧有等效3pF大小的寄生电容。当二极管悬浮连接的时候;寄生电容就构成了耦合结构而产生了自激或微分耦合波形。因此;要可用,此电路得大改了。
鉴于你只是传递高速逻辑信号,建议用6N37等光耦来实现你的功能,一方面更可靠;还可以省去珍贵得模拟放大口而直接接逻辑口即可。